CVE-2026-26119
Windows Admin Center vulnerability analysis and mitigation

Overview

CVE-2026-26119 is an improper authentication vulnerability in Microsoft Windows Admin Center that allows an authorized (low-privileged) attacker to elevate privileges over a network. It affects all versions of Windows Admin Center prior to version 2511. The vulnerability was published on February 17, 2026, with a patch released on the same date. It carries a CVSS v3.1 base score of 8.8 (High) (Microsoft MSRC).

Technical details

The vulnerability is classified as CWE-287 (Improper Authentication), meaning the application fails to adequately verify the identity or authorization level of a user during certain network-based operations. An attacker with low-level network access to a Windows Admin Center instance can exploit this flaw to bypass authentication controls and escalate their privileges to administrative levels without requiring user interaction. The attack vector is network-based, requires low privileges, and has low attack complexity, making it straightforward to exploit once access to the management interface is available. Related attack patterns include authentication bypass (CAPEC-115), token impersonation (CAPEC-633), and adversary-in-the-middle techniques (CAPEC-94) (Microsoft MSRC, Synacktiv).

Impact

Successful exploitation grants a low-privileged attacker full administrative control over the Windows Admin Center management interface and the systems it manages, resulting in high impact to confidentiality, integrity, and availability. Because Windows Admin Center is typically used to manage multiple Windows servers and infrastructure components, a successful privilege escalation could enable lateral movement across managed systems, domain-level compromise, and complete data exfiltration. The vulnerability has been described as potentially enabling domain takeover in environments where Windows Admin Center manages domain-joined servers (Microsoft MSRC, CtrlAltNod).

Exploitability

As of the time of reporting, there is no confirmed public proof-of-concept exploit or evidence of active in-the-wild exploitation (Microsoft MSRC). The EPSS score is approximately 0.078%, indicating a currently low probability of exploitation in the near term. The vulnerability is not listed in the CISA Known Exploited Vulnerabilities (KEV) catalog. Nessus detection (plugin ID 302151) is available for identifying vulnerable instances. A reference to a potential proof-of-exploit was noted at cybervizer.com, though this has not been independently confirmed as a working exploit (Feedly).

Exploitation steps

  1. Reconnaissance: Identify Windows Admin Center instances accessible over the network using port scanning tools (e.g., Nmap targeting default ports 443 or 6516) or asset discovery platforms like Shodan, focusing on versions prior to 2511.
  2. Obtain low-privileged access: Acquire any valid low-privileged account credential for the target environment (e.g., a standard domain user account), which is the only prerequisite for exploitation.
  3. Access Windows Admin Center: Authenticate to the Windows Admin Center web interface using the low-privileged credentials over HTTPS.
  4. Exploit improper authentication: Leverage the authentication flaw (CWE-287) by manipulating authentication tokens, session parameters, or API requests to bypass privilege checks — potentially through token impersonation or authentication reflection techniques — to escalate to administrative privileges within the application.
  5. Achieve administrative control: With elevated privileges, use Windows Admin Center's built-in management capabilities (remote PowerShell, file system access, service management) to execute commands on managed servers, move laterally, or establish persistence (Microsoft MSRC, Synacktiv).

Indicators of compromise

  • Network: Unusual or repeated authentication requests to Windows Admin Center (default ports 443/6516) from low-privileged accounts followed by administrative-level API calls; unexpected outbound connections from the Windows Admin Center host to internal servers.
  • Logs: Windows Admin Center event logs showing privilege escalation or role changes for standard user accounts; authentication events (Event ID 4624, 4648) reflecting unexpected privilege levels for known low-privileged accounts; anomalous PowerShell remoting sessions (Event ID 4103, 4104) initiated from the Admin Center service account.
  • Process: Unexpected PowerShell or cmd.exe processes spawned under the Windows Admin Center service context (SMEDesktop or SMEService); unusual WinRM sessions to managed servers originating from the Admin Center host.
  • File System: New scheduled tasks, scripts, or binaries placed on managed servers following Admin Center access; unexpected changes to local administrator group membership on managed hosts.

Mitigation and workarounds

Microsoft has released a patch in Windows Admin Center version 2511, which addresses this vulnerability; organizations should upgrade immediately (Microsoft MSRC). As interim mitigations, restrict network access to the Windows Admin Center management interface to trusted networks and administrative jump hosts only, using firewall rules or network segmentation. Monitor for suspicious authentication attempts and privilege escalation activities within Windows Admin Center logs. Limit the number of accounts with access to the Windows Admin Center portal and enforce multi-factor authentication where supported.

Community reactions

The vulnerability received broad coverage across security media outlets including The Hacker News, GBHackers, Help Net Security, SC World, eWeek, eSecurity Planet, and Heise, with many characterizing it as a critical risk to enterprise environments (The Hacker News, Help Net Security). Security researchers highlighted the potential for domain takeover given Windows Admin Center's role in managing enterprise infrastructure. The SANS Internet Storm Center discussed the vulnerability in a podcast episode, and the NHS UK issued a cyber alert (CC-4747) advising healthcare organizations to patch promptly (NHS Cyber Alert). Community discussion on Reddit and Bluesky reflected concern about the management-plane exposure, with some noting that organizations often expose Windows Admin Center more broadly than recommended.
